/*
 Theme Name:     Savia Child Theme
 Description:    Savia Child Theme
 Author:         BlueOwlCreative
 Template:       Savia

*/
@import url(../Savia/style.css);@import url(https://fonts.googleapis.com/css?family=Montserrat:100,100i,200,200i,300,300i,400,400i,500,500i,600,600i,700,700i,800,800i,900,900i);.post_item .pic{height:426px;overflow:hidden}.post_item .pic img{width:100%}.zips_box{width:400px!important;text-align:center!important}.zips_box ul{list-style:none!important;list-style-type:none!important;display:inline-block!important;font-size:18px!important;font-weight:500!important;padding-top:12px!important;padding-left:8px!important;padding-right:8px!important}.zips_box li{padding-top:8px!important;padding-bottom:8px!important}.Zebra_Tooltip .Zebra_Tooltip_Message{padding:8px!important}.home .Zebra_Tooltip_Message iframe{margin-top:0!important;height:400px!important}.header_login ul{float:right;margin-bottom:0}.header_login li{display:inline-block;padding-left:12px;font-size:12px}.page-id-1537 .container{width:100%;text-align:center}.page-id-1537 div.container.startNow{width:1200px}.page-id-1537 .container .page_heading{text-align:left}.page-id-1537 .container .sixteen.columns{width:98%}.page-id-1537 div#footer .container{width:1200px}.page-id-1537 div#footer .sixteen{width:1170px}.page-id-1537 .content_bgr{margin-bottom:0}.page-id-1537 #footer .four,.page-id-1537 #footer .textwidget,.page-id-1537 #footer li .page-id-1537 #footer h3,.page-id-1537 #footer p{text-align:left!important}.delivery_service{text-align:center}.delivery_service .wrap{width:100%}.delivery_service .page-content{padding:0!important}body .ser_tmp li{float:left!important}.sngl_serv .ser_tmp p{min-height:210px}.sngl_serv .ser_tmp p br{display:none}@media only screen and (max-width :1280px){body .ser_tmp li{float:left!important;width:30.2%!important}.sngl_serv .ser_tmp p{min-height:120px}}@media only screen and (max-width :1024px){body .ser_tmp li{float:none!important;width:30.6%!important;margin-bottom:67px}}@media only screen and (max-width :767px){body .ser_tmp li{width:100%!important}.sngl_serv .ser_tmp p{min-height:100%}}@media only screen and (min-width :320px){.box_back{width:100%;display:block}}@media only screen and (min-width :768px){.box_back{width:667px;height:auto;display:inline-block}}.box_back{text-align:left;font-family:"Open Sans",sans-serif;background:#3b3b3b;opacity:1;margin-top:30px;margin-bottom:60px;border-radius:6px;box-shadow:0 0 10px 2px rgba(0,0,0,.2)}@media only screen and (min-width :320px){.box_back:nth-child(odd){margin-right:0}.box_back:nth-child(even){margin-left:0}}@media only screen and (min-width :768px){.box_back:nth-child(odd){margin-right:10px}.box_back:nth-child(even){margin-left:10px}}@media only screen and (min-width :320px){.box_left{padding-bottom:30px}.box_right{padding-bottom:30px}}@media only screen and (min-width :768px){.box_left{padding-bottom:0}.box_right{padding-bottom:0;margin-left:0}}.box_left,.box_right{height:auto;border-radius:6px;opacity:.6;transition:opacity .3s ease;-webkit-transform:translateZ(0);margin-top:-20px}.box_left:hover,.box_right:hover{opacity:1}@media only screen and (min-width :320px){.box_left{background:#fff url(images/choose/box_mobile.jpg) left top no-repeat}.box_right{background:#fff url(images/choose/box_mobile.jpg) left top no-repeat}}@media only screen and (min-width :768px){.box_left{background:url(images/choose/box_left.jpg) right bottom no-repeat}.box_right{background:url(images/choose/box_right.jpg) right bottom no-repeat}}.box_back h4{text-align:center;text-transform:none;color:#83c941;font-size:24pt;padding-top:70px;font-weight:600}.box_back h4 strong{text-transform:uppercase;color:#4a9701;font-weight:700}.box_back h5{text-align:center;text-transform:none;color:#0569a8;margin-top:14px}.box_back ul{font-size:8pt;text-align:left;list-style:disc;list-style-position:inside;margin-top:40px;margin-left:40px}.box_back li{font-weight:600;padding-bottom:12px}.first_li{color:#84c941!important;cursor:pointer!important}.inner_li{font-size:14pt}.br{display:block;padding-top:10px;padding-left:16px;padding-bottom:10px;font-style:italic}.box_back .button{margin-top:40px;-webkit-transform:translateZ(0)}@media only screen and (min-width :320px){.box_back .button{margin-left:50px}}@media only screen and (min-width :768px){.box_back .button{margin-left:40px}}.box_back .button a{text-align:left;color:#fff;text-transform:uppercase;font-weight:700;font-size:18px;text-shadow:0 0 10px 2px rgba(0,0,0,.2);letter-spacing:2px;height:48px;border-radius:4px;padding:0}.box_back .button a:hover{text-decoration:none;opacity:.9}.box_back .button a:active{position:relative;top:1px}.box_onload{opacity:1}.zips_box{width:300px;text-align:center}.zips_box ul{display:inline-block;font-family:"Open Sans",sans-serif;font-size:18px;font-weight:500;padding-top:12px;padding-left:8px;padding-right:8px}.zips_box li{padding-top:8px;padding-bottom:8px}.Zebra_Tooltip .Zebra_Tooltip_Message{padding:8px!important}.page-id-152 textarea{max-width:460px}#zip-table table{margin:0 auto;border:1px solid #8a8a8a;border-bottom:0;width:80%}#zip-table colgroup#colgroup.colgroup{width:230px}#zip-table tr{border-bottom:1px solid #8a8a8a;line-height:22px}#zip-table td,#zip-table th{color:#818e96;padding:10px 25px}#zip-table th:nth-child(even){text-align:right}.clean_list{list-style-image:url(/wp-content/uploads/2016/07/check.png)}.clean_list li{padding-top:4px;padding-bottom:4px}.clean_list li span{position:relative;top:-6px;font-size:18px;font-style:italic}.add_list{list-style-type:none}.add_list li{font-size:18px}.inner_list li{font-size:14px}.add_list li div,.add_list li p{float:left}.add_list li{clear:both;padding-top:6px;padding-bottom:6px}.add_list ul{margin-top:-2px;padding-bottom:4px}.add_list ul li{padding-top:2px;padding-bottom:2px}body.page-id-1563{background:#fff}#get-price{text-align:center}#get-price input{text-align:center;margin:0 auto 10px auto}.acc_control{border-radius:17px;margin-top:4px;margin-right:8px}.overlay{background:0 0;position:relative;width:100%;height:700px;top:700px;margin-top:-700px}.aqua_table{margin:20px auto!important}.basic-link{display:block;margin-top:30px;color:#00f!important;text-decoration:underline}.basic-link:hover{color:red!important}#txtPlaces{font-weight:500!important;border:0!important;border-radius:0!important}.sign_up h1{font-family:Montserrat,sans-serif!important;font-weight:600!important;text-align:center!important;text-transform:uppercase!important;text-align:center!important}.sign_up h1 strong{font-weight:600!important;color:#07bee5!important}.sngl_serv{padding:60px 0 80px}.sngl_serv .ser_tmp{float:left;width:100%}.sngl_serv .ser_tmp i{color:#07bee5;border:2px solid;border-radius:100%;padding:0;width:70px;height:70px;text-align:center;line-height:70px}.sngl_serv .ser_tmp h3{margin-top:35px;margin-bottom:25px;font-family:Montserrat,sans-serif!important;font-weight:600}.sngl_serv .ser_tmp h3::after{width:80px;height:3px;background:#eee;display:block;content:'';left:0;right:0;margin:15px auto 0}.sngl_serv .ser_tmp p{color:#888b8f;line-height:26px}ul.ser_tmp{width:100%;float:left;list-style-type:none;margin:0;text-align:center}.ser_tmp li{width:17%!important;max-width:auto!important;float:none!important;display:inline-block;margin:0 0 50px;padding:0 15px;text-align:center}.ser_tmp span{color:#fff;font-size:17px!important;padding:9px 28px!important;font-weight:600!important;-webkit-border-radius:30px!important;-moz-border-radius:30px!important;border-radius:30px!important;background:#eee!important;text-transform:uppercase!important;cursor:no-drop!important}.ser_tmp a.big-button,.wash-detail a{color:#fff!important;font-size:17px!important;font-weight:600!important;padding:9px 28px!important;-webkit-border-radius:30px!important;-moz-border-radius:30px!important;border-radius:30px!important;background:#fd8e00!important;background:-moz-linear-gradient(90deg,#fd8e00 30%,#fda500 70%)!important;background:-webkit-linear-gradient(90deg,#fd8e00 30%,#fda500 70%)!important;background:-o-linear-gradient(90deg,#fd8e00 30%,#fda500 70%)!important;background:-ms-linear-gradient(90deg,#fd8e00 30%,#fda500 70%)!important;background:linear-gradient(0deg,#fd8e00 30%,#fda500 70%)!important;cursor:pointer!important;text-transform:uppercase!important}.ser_tmp a.big-button:hover,.wash-detail a:hover{background:#84b74e}.ser_tmp span{background:gray!important}#menu-header-login .menu-item-2773 a{padding:4px 12px 6px 15px!important;border-radius:30px!important;background:#ec9900!important;color:#fff!important;font-weight:700!important}
#menu>ul>li>a{padding:8px 0 0 16px}.aqua_table{margin:20px auto!important}.new_table td:nth-child(2n+2){background-color:#ffb9b7;background-color:rgba(255,185,183,.6)}.new_table td:nth-child(3n+3){background-color:#d4e7c2;background-color:rgba(212,231,194,.5)}.icon.one:before{position:relative;top:-3px;content:"1";font-family:NovecentowideLightBold,arial,serif}.icon.two:before{position:relative;top:-3px;content:"2";font-family:NovecentowideLightBold,arial,serif}.icon.three:before{position:relative;top:-3px;content:"3";font-family:NovecentowideLightBold,arial,serif}.icon.handshake:before{content:url(/wp-content/uploads/2019/02/handshake-icon-reg.png)}.section_featured_texts.type3:hover .icon_holder .icon.handshake:before{content:url(/wp-content/uploads/2019/02/handshake-icon-hover.png)}.icon.delivery:before{content:url(/wp-content/uploads/2019/02/mailbox-icon-reg.png);position:relative;left:-2px}.section_featured_texts.type3:hover .icon_holder .icon.delivery:before{content:url(/wp-content/uploads/2019/02/mailbox-icon-hover.png)}.icon.mailbox:before{content:url(/wp-content/uploads/2019/02/delivery-icon-reg.png);position:relative;left:-2px;top:3px}.section_featured_texts.type3:hover .icon_holder .icon.mailbox:before{content:url(/wp-content/uploads/2019/02/delivery-icon-hover.png)}.cls_login_details{display:none}.full_header{border-bottom:none}@media only screen and (max-width:959px){.header_login{display:none}.cls_login_details{display:block}.block_header #logo .logo_img{margin:0}#mobile_menu_toggler{top:0}.main_side_bar{float:left!important;margin-left:20px}.our_services_middle_part .one-third.column{width:334px!important;padding:0 20px}}@media only screen and (max-width:1250px){.container .sixteen.columns{width:99%}.container{width:100%}}@media only screen and (max-width:1043px) and (min-width:960px){#header #menu>ul>li>a{padding-left:0!important;padding-right:9px!important}}
#mobile_menu ul li a
{color:#000;font-size:13px;display:block;position:relative;padding:12px 30px;text-shadow:1px 1px 0 rgb(0 0 0 / 30%);-webkit-transition:all .2s ease-out;-moz-transition:all .2s ease-out;-ms-transition:all .2s ease-out;-o-transition:all .2s ease-out;transition:all .2s ease-out;background-color:#fff}
#mobile_menu>ul>li a{background:#fff;border-top:1px solid rgba(255,255,255,.1);border-bottom:1px solid rgba(0,0,0,.3)}
#mobile_menu>ul>li>a:hover{background:#fff}
.heighlight_color_menu a{background:#fea700!important;color:#fff!important}
#mobile_menu>ul>li ul li a{background:0 0;border-top:1px solid rgba(255,255,255,.1);border-bottom:1px solid rgba(0,0,0,.3);background-color:#fff}
#mobile_menu ul li a:hover{color:#000}

@media only screen and (max-width:600px){#rev_slider_8_1_forcefullwidth{display:none}.why_greener_cleaner_cls .nine{width:334px!important;padding:0 20px}.why_greener_cleaner_cls .seven{text-align:center;width:334px!important;padding:0 20px}}.chicagoland_section_main{background-color:#f8f8f8}.chicagoland_section_main p{display:none}.main_side_bar{text-align:center;padding-top:40px;float:right;background:#2664a6;padding-bottom:20px;border-radius:61px;padding:20px}.sidebar_button{margin:30px 0}.main_side_bar a.tiny_button{font-size:14px;padding:15px 18px;line-height:16px;width:200px}.main_side_bar h3{color:#fff;font-size:23px;font-weight:700}@media only screen and (max-width:768px){.services_main_detail{margin:0 10px 10px 10px}.service_sub_content{margin-top:10px;float:inherit}.services_main_detail img{width:100%;text-align:center}.services_main_detail p,.services_main_detail ul{font-size:14px}.container .one-third.column{width:370px!important}.mobile_non_responsive_option .four{width:330px!important;padding:0 20px;text-align:justify}}@media (orientation:landscape){.simplesteps .container .one-third.column{width:100%!important}}@media only screen and (max-width:768px){.single-post .blog_list_page .twelve{width:90%;padding-left:5%}.single-post .blog_list_page .twelve p{font-size:15px;word-wrap:break-word}.single-post .full_container_page_title{padding-left:5%}}.rs_error_message_content{display:none}@media only screen and (max-width:768px){.container .one-third.column{width:100%!important}.why_greener_cleaner_cls .seven{width:100%!important}.why_greener_cleaner_cls .nine{width:100%!important}.savia_button{float:left}.slider_div{display:none}.simple_sahre_tooltip{display:block;height:20px;max-height:100%;max-width:100%;min-height:100%;min-width:100%;width:0;margin-top:20px}.team_image{height:235px}.our_service_content{margin-left:-35px}}

.heighlight_color_menu a{background:#fea700!important;color:#fff!important}
#amp_logo {text-align: center;margin-top: 10px;}

/* Mobile Menu Styles */
#amp_mobile_menu { display: none;}
.button-toggle-menu {cursor: pointer;font-size: 25px;padding: 10px 20px;width: 10px;height: 20px;background-color: #f2f2f2;-webkit-border-radius: 3px;-moz-border-radius: 3px;border-radius: 3px;margin: 0 auto 3px;transition: background-color .2s;border: 1px solid #ececec;}
.amp_mobileoverlay {background: #000000 !important;opacity: 0.1;pointer-events: none;transition: 0.3s opacity ease-in-out;}
.toggle-menu {appearance: none;}
.toggle-menu:checked ~ nav {transform: translateX(0);}
.toggle-menu:checked ~ .amp_mobileoverlay {pointer-events: initial;}
.toggle-menu:checked ~ .chicagoland_section_main {opacity: 0.1;}
nav { position: absolute;background: #000000 !important;width: 100%;transform: translateX(-100%);will-change: transform;transition: 0.3s transform linear;z-index: 1;}
#amp_mobile_menu {display: block;position: absolute;}
#amp_mobile_menu ul {list-style: none;}
#amp_mobile_menu ul li a{color:#fff;font-size:14px;display:block;position:relative;padding:8px 0px 9px 0px;text-shadow:1px 1px 0 rgb(0 0 0 / 30%);-webkit-transition:all .2s ease-out;-moz-transition:all .2s ease-out;-ms-transition:all .2s ease-out;-o-transition:all .2s ease-out;transition:all .2s ease-out;font-weight: bold;}
#amp_mobile_menu>ul>li a{text-decoration: none;border-bottom:1px solid rgba(255,255,255,.2);}
/* #amp_mobile_menu>ul>li ul li a{background:0 0;border-top:1px solid rgba(255,255,255,.1);border-bottom:1px solid rgba(0,0,0,.3);} */
#amp_mobile_menu ul li a:hover{color:#fff;}
#amp_mobile_menu .sub-menu{display:none;}
/* Mobile Menu Styles Code End */